Subject: Re: Stateless NAT in nftables with maps for performance
Date: Fri, 12 Sep 2025 14:23:46 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<aMQQ0vB83DCfeboy@strlen.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<aMQMg33uIM63vKAC@strlen.de>

Florian Westphal <fw@strlen.de> wrote:
> ip daddr set ip daddr map @dnat_map

Forgot the usual disclaimer: this breaks icmp(v6).

There is a reason for existence of stateful nat after all.
